White Chocolate Crème Brûlée

White Chocolate Crème Brûlée

Ingredients and Methods

Preparation
15 min
Cooking
30 min
Makes
4
Serves
4

Ingredients

  • 500ml Cream
  • 50g Sugar
  • 130g White Chocolate
  • 5 Egg Yolks

Instructions

Bring cream to a simmer, add chocolate and whisk in.

Take off heat.

Whisk sugar and egg yolks together in a separate bowl.

Pour slightly cooled cream onto yolks slowly at the start so as to not scramble the eggs yolks.

Mix and then strain amongst 4 serving dishes.

Place serving dishes on oven tray and surround with hot water.

Bake in a 130C oven for 30mins then check how wobbly they are.

When the brûlée's have a slight wobble, take them out and cool them on the bench before placing in the fridge to set.

To Serve

Sprinkle a small amount of sugar on the top of each, shaking off excess and lightly blow torch until golden brown.

Chef Emma Parker

Emma started her work experience at a winery restaurant and small hotel in Central Otago New Zealand, before beginning a Modern Apprenticeship at the award winning Hermitage Hotel in Mt Cook New Zealand. Working with Executive Chef Franz Blum, Emma gained extensive experience in every facet of the kitchen. (more)
